titleOfInvention | Composition for conditioning surfaces and method for conditioning surfaces |
abstract | A composition for conditioning surfaces comprising a titanium phosphate compound and having a pH from 3 to 12, composition for conditioning surfaces which further comprises: - an amine compound represented by the following general formula (1): where, R1, R2, and R3 are each selected from the group consisting of a hydrogen atom, a linear or branched alkyl group having 1 to 10 carbon atoms, and a linear or branched alkyl group having 1 to 10 carbon atoms and which it has a polar group in its skeleton; and R1, R2, and R3 are not all a hydrogen atom, and - at least one compound selected from the group consisting of an aromatic organic acid, phenolic compounds having a phenolic hydroxyl group and a phenolic resin. |
